Advanced Drying TechnologyThis soybean dryer machine is equipped with cutting-edge automatic technology and PLC control systems, ensuring precise, uniform drying of soybeans. The belt dryer design facilitates continuous processing, making it a preferred choice for high-throughput industrial and commercial operations.
Versatile Fuel and Power OptionsDesigned for practicality, the dryer can operate using diesel, gas, or biomass briquettes, offering flexibility in choosing the most cost-effective and readily available energy source. Operating on 415 volts and powered by a 5 HP motor, it is energy-efficient for large-scale applications.

Q: How does the Soybean Dryer Machine operate for industrial and commercial usage?
A: The machine uses an automatic belt dryer system, controlled via a PLC interface, to dry large quantities of soybeans efficiently. Soybeans are loaded onto the belt, where they pass through temperature-controlled zones powered by diesel, gas, or biomass briquettes, ensuring uniform drying.

Q: What is the process for drying soybeans using this automatic machine?
A: Soybeans are loaded into the input conveyor, and the belt carries them through the dryer zones. The system uses the selected heat sourcediesel, gas, or biomass briquetteswhile the PLC control maintains precise temperatures, ensuring thorough, even removal of moisture.
Q: How does the PLC control system enhance the drying operation?
A: The PLC system allows operators to monitor and adjust temperature, speed, and timing automatically, ensuring optimal drying conditions for different soybean loads. This results in improved efficiency, safety, and product quality compared to manual control.
